Finances
- The property taxes average 2.40% of total income, which is medium compared to the national median.
- The property taxes average 1.34% of total property value, which is high compared to the national median.
- The sales tax rate is 7.00%, which is medium compared to the national median.
- Pennsylvania has a low average state income tax rate of 3.07%.
- The area has an average household income of $53,198, which is in the top 62% of all incomes in the US.
- The area has a median household income of $44,250, which is in the top 58% of all incomes in the US.
- The area has a per capita income of $21,783, which is in the top 60% of all per capita incomes in the US.
- Assisted living costs average $30,936 per year, which are very low compared to national figures.
- Nursing home costs average $87,600 per year, which are medium compared to national costs.
- Adult daycare costs average $27,248 per year, which are very high compared to national numbers.
- Home healthcare costs average $41,481 annually, which are low compared to national costs.
- The unemployment rate is about 6.37%, which is low compared to national statistics.
- The overall cost of living is low compared to national averages.
- 1% of the senior population are financially responsible for at least one grandchild.
